There is no way to remove a Sub Scene when the Entities package is removed
Steps to reproduce:
- Create a new Unity project and install the Entities package
- Enable the New Hierarchy from Settings > General > New Hierarchy > Use new Hierarchy window
- Create a new Sub Scene in the Hierarchy window
- Remove the Entities package
- Right click the Sub Scene in the Hierarchy window
- Observe the context menu
Actual results: There is no way to remove the Sub Scene
Expected results: There is an option to remove the Sub Scene
Reproducible with versions: 6000.3.2f1, 6000.4.0b2, 6000.5.0a3
Could not test with: 6000.0.64f1, 6000.2.15f1, 6000.3.0a1 (due to no Hierarchy V2)
Tested on (OS): MacOS Silicon Tahoe 26.0.1
Notes:
- Deleting the Sub Scene's asset file in the Project Browser does not remove the Sub Scene from the Hierarchy as well
- The issue does not reproduce with the old Hierarchy, only Hierarchy V2
